The Receptionist for the Office of Admission serves as the first and most important point of contact for prospective students, families, campus visitors, and university stakeholders. This position requires a warm, professional presence, excellent communication abilities, and strong organizational skills. The ideal candidate will deliver an exceptional first impression while efficiently supporting the administrative and event-related operations of the Admissions Office.
Job Duties:
Greeting all guests in a courteous, professional, and welcoming manner.
Answer incoming calls with clarity and professionalism; respond to general inquiries and route calls appropriately to Admissions Counselors, Processors, Assistant Directors, or the Dean.
Maintain a helpful, positive demeanor in all in-person and phone interactions.
Open, sort, and distribute incoming mail in a timely and efficient manner.
Assist in the planning, preparation, and execution of high-impact recruitment events.
Demonstrate strong punctuality, reliability, and attention to detail in all duties.
Provide exceptional customer service to all visitors, students, parents, and staff.
Remain composed and courteous under pressure, especially during periods of high call volume or foot traffic.
Ensure a professional tone and polished appearance are always maintained.
Qualifications:
High School Diploma or equivalent.
Exceptional verbal communication and interpersonal skills.
Proven ability to multitask, prioritize responsibilities, and remain organized in a fast-paced environment.
Previous experience in a receptionist or customer service role.
Professional, approachable appearance and demeanor.
Familiarity with college admissions processes or higher education environments is a plus.
Requirements:
Utilize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Publisher) and DocuSign for routine clerical and document management tasks.
Navigate office systems, email platforms, and digital tools with proficiency.
